Frequently Asked Questions About Restoration in Robson

Get answers to common questions about restoration services in Robson, West Virginia.

1What are the most common causes of property damage requiring restoration in Robson, WV?

The most frequent causes in our area are water damage from heavy Appalachian rainfall and flash flooding, especially in low-lying areas near the Kanawha River and its tributaries. We also see significant fire and smoke damage from wood-burning stoves and heating systems common in older homes, as well as storm damage from high winds and occasional severe thunderstorms that sweep through the valley.

2How quickly should I respond to water damage, and are there seasonal considerations in Robson?

You must act within 24-48 hours to prevent mold growth, which is a major concern in West Virginia's humid climate, particularly in the summer months. In winter, frozen pipes in unheated crawl spaces or additions are a common issue; prompt action is needed to mitigate water damage once thawing occurs. Delays can lead to structural rot and more costly repairs.

3What should I look for when choosing a local restoration company in the Robson area?

Always verify the company is licensed and insured to work in West Virginia. Choose a provider with 24/7 emergency response who is familiar with Robson's specific challenges, such as older home construction (e.g., plaster, knob-and-tube wiring) and local permitting processes. Check for certifications from the IICRC and seek out local references or reviews from Boone or Kanawha County residents.

4Does homeowner's insurance in West Virginia typically cover restoration costs?

Most standard policies cover sudden incidents like burst pipes or fire, but often exclude flooding, which requires separate flood insurance—a wise consideration given Robson's proximity to waterways. It's crucial to document all damage with photos before any cleanup and to understand your policy's specific deductibles and limits. Always contact your insurer immediately after securing the property.

5How long does a typical fire or smoke damage restoration project take in this region?

The timeline varies greatly, but a standard residential project can take several weeks to a few months. Factors specific to our area include the availability of specialized materials for historic home features, potential delays due to mountainous terrain for equipment delivery, and the thorough process of removing soot and the persistent, pungent odor of smoke that can embed into wood common in local homes.
